Transaction 66a4062e243c1862c661a8c7381adaa569840b93bb206a9c7869050883e566ed
1 Input
1 Output
-
66a4062e243c1862c661a8c7381adaa569840b93bb206a9c7869050883e566ed:0
- value
- 461000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 395b143498f4a1cf06be8f8adfde2e59827c6436 OP_EQUAL
- address
- 36vHYkd4vvqnAJmGjbLthjnfHftBqbn9LQ